January 18, 2025The Trump administration appointed Mike Banks, a former Border Patrol agent and Texas official, to lead the U.S. Border Patrol. This appointment marks the first time in the agency’s history that a political appointee will hold the position. Retiring Chief Jason Owens expressed hope that the new leader will remain impartial and focused on law enforcement rather than politics.
